Output ed17d5893ea1ddaa911063c39cedf3d00a9cf6fa8721e2df0e7399bfd090e68d:0

value
1025679
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c1381bab4bccf0c354ca07c8e99c8aa02cf1ef46b41008f34141009659c3dc4
address
bc1p8sfcrw45hn8scd2v5p7gaxwg4gpv78h5ddqspre5zsgqjevu8hzqxyu59d
transaction
ed17d5893ea1ddaa911063c39cedf3d00a9cf6fa8721e2df0e7399bfd090e68d
confirmations
20184
spent
true